Understanding Informatics Developer Salaries

The average salary for an informatics developer is approximately $93,099 annually, which translates to about $45 per hour. This figure can vary significantly based on factors such as geographical location, years of experience, and specific job responsibilities.

Factors Influencing Salaries

  • Experience: Entry-level positions typically start lower, while seasoned developers can command higher wages.
  • Location: States like California and New York often offer higher salaries due to demand.
  • Specialization: Developers working in specialized fields may see increased compensation.

With the increasing integration of technology in healthcare, opportunities for informatics developers are expanding. This trend suggests that potential earnings may continue to rise, making it an attractive career path for those with the right skills.

The average informatics developer salary has risen by $17,283 over the last ten years. In 2014, the average informatics developer earned $75,816 annually, but today, they earn $93,099 a year. That works out to a 10% change in pay for informatics developers over the last decade.
